AOL UK recruits Steckler to UK post

 

AOL has appointed Michael Steckler as managing director of AOL UK as part of a global realignment that will see it roll out a global integrated advertising platform.

Steckler joined AOL UK from MSN in July as vice-president of interactive marketing, as well as interim managing director.

His appointment comes as AOL unveils Platform A, which will offer advertisers access to targeting and measurement tools across the platform's network of third-party sites, as well as sites owned and operated by AOL.

Platform A builds on Advertising.com, which operates the largest third-party display network, and integrates behavioural targeting company Tacoda, mobile media network operator Third Screen Media, video ad-serving platform Lightningcast and Adtech's global ad-serving platform.

AOL also announced that it would move its corporate headquarters to New York from Dulles, Virginia.
